Key Factors That Define Superior Dash Cam Video Quality
What makes a dash cam image sharp is the first step. It goes far beyond just the megapixels advertised on the box.
True clarity is a combination of hardware and software working together. This ensures footage is usable in all lighting conditions.
Hardware Components for Crystal Clear Footage
The lens and image sensor are the camera’s eyes. A wide-aperture lens captures more light, especially at night.
A larger sensor, like a Sony STARVIS, performs better in low light with less grain. This combination is critical for detail.
High-end models use multi-element glass lenses to reduce distortion. This keeps straight lines straight at the edges of the frame.
Resolution and Frame Rate for Detail and Smoothness
4K Ultra HD resolution provides the most detail for reading distant signs. However, it requires ample storage space.
A high frame rate, like 60fps at 1440p, creates smoother slow-motion playback. This is invaluable for analyzing fast-moving events.
Many top dash cams offer dual recording modes. You can choose between maximum detail (4K) and optimized performance (1440p/60fps).
Advanced Image Processing Technologies
Software enhancements correct for challenging real-world conditions. They compensate for what the hardware physically captures.
High Dynamic Range (HDR) balances bright skies and dark shadows. This prevents overexposed or completely black areas in your video.
Advanced night vision uses specific algorithms to reduce noise. It brightens dark scenes without making headlights look like blinding orbs.
Other key processing features include:
- Wide Dynamic Range (WDR): A real-time version of HDR for moving scenes.
- Image Stabilization: Minimizes blur from road vibrations and bumps.
- Polarizing Filter Support: Reduces dashboard reflections and windshield glare dramatically.

Specifications vs. Real-World Results
A high megapixel count does not guarantee a better image. Sensor quality and processing are more significant factors.
Some 1440p cameras outperform cheaper 4K models in overall clarity. The lens and image processor determine the final output.
Always trust verified user footage over manufacturer promotional videos. Real-world results are the ultimate specification.
Optimizing Your Dash Cam for Maximum Video Clarity
Even the best dash cam needs proper setup. Correct installation and settings are crucial for optimal picture quality.
Small adjustments can dramatically improve your recorded footage. Follow these steps to ensure your camera performs at its peak.
Installation Tips to Eliminate Blur and Glare
Mount the camera firmly on the windshield to reduce vibration blur. Ensure the lens is clean, both inside and outside the vehicle.
Position the camera centrally behind the rearview mirror. This provides an unobstructed view and minimizes windshield curvature distortion.
Use a built-in or add-on polarizing filter. This simple accessory cuts dashboard reflections and glare dramatically.
Essential Settings for Day and Night Recording
Manually adjust the exposure (EV) setting for your common driving environments. Slightly negative EV can prevent overexposed skies.
Always enable High Dynamic Range (HDR) or WDR if available. This is the most important setting for balanced exposure.
For night driving, experiment with the parking mode motion sensitivity. Setting it too high can cause false recordings from headlights.
Maintenance for Consistent Long-Term Performance
Regularly format your memory card within the dash cam every few weeks. This prevents file corruption and maintains write speed.
Periodically check the lens for dust, fingerprints, or interior fogging. A microfiber cloth is essential for a clear view.
Verify your power connection is secure. A loose cable can cause the camera to shut off unexpectedly, missing critical footage.

Common Mistakes That Ruin Dash Cam Video Quality
Many users unknowingly degrade their camera’s performance. Avoiding these errors is as important as choosing the right hardware.
Even premium dash cams can produce poor footage if set up incorrectly. Awareness of these pitfalls protects your investment.
Installation and Placement Errors to Avoid
Never mount the camera in front of a dotted or shaded windshield area. This can confuse the light sensor and auto-exposure.
Avoid placing the lens too close to the windshield’s edge. The curved glass creates a fisheye distortion that software cannot fix.
Do not let cables dangle in front of the lens. This seems obvious but is a frequent cause of blocked footage.
Critical Settings That Often Get Overlooked
Leaving the resolution on a default lower setting is a common error. Always manually select the highest available resolution.
Disabling crucial features like WDR or HDR to save battery is counterproductive. These are essential for usable video evidence.
Using a slow, non-endurance microSD card will cause dropped frames and corruption. This directly ruins video smoothness and reliability.
Maintenance and Usage Pitfalls
Neglecting to clean the lens regularly is a major cause of blurry video. Dust and grime accumulate slowly, degrading image quality over time.
Assuming parking mode works perfectly without testing it is risky. Test it in your own garage to verify motion detection sensitivity.
Failing to update the camera’s firmware means missing key performance improvements. Manufacturers often release updates that enhance video processing.
Ignoring these factors can render your evidence useless:
- Over-reliance on Auto Mode: Manual tweaks for your specific environment are often necessary.
- Wrong Screen Brightness: A dazzling screen preview can mask poor actual video file quality.
- Ignoring Temperature Limits: Extreme heat can cause focus drift and sensor damage over time.

Frequently Asked Questions about Which Dash Cam Has The Best Picture Quality
Is 4K resolution always better than 1080p for a dash cam?
Not always. While 4K captures more detail, it requires a superior sensor and lens to be effective. Many 1440p or 1080p cameras with premium components outperform cheap 4K models.
The higher resolution also demands more storage and processing power. For many users, a high-bitrate 1440p camera offers the best balance of detail, file size, and low-light performance.

How important is HDR or WDR for dash cam video quality?
Extremely important. These features manage the extreme contrast between bright skies and dark shadows. Without them, details are lost in overexposed or underexposed areas.
HDR (High Dynamic Range) is crucial for capturing license plates in tunnels or during sunrise/sunset. Always ensure this feature is enabled in your camera’s settings for usable evidence.

Do I need to buy a special memory card for a high-quality dash cam?
Yes, a high-endurance card is essential. Standard cards are not designed for the constant writing and rewriting of dash cam footage, leading to premature failure.
Always use a card rated for continuous video surveillance. This prevents corruption and ensures your critical high-resolution footage is saved without errors or dropped frames.
